Joe Gomez and Jordon Ibe Named in England U21 Squad for USA and Norway Matches

Gianni VerschuerenAug 25, 2015

Liverpool stars Jordon Ibe and Joe Gomez have been awarded their first call-ups for England's under-21 team, joining Gareth Southgate's 23-man squad for their upcoming friendly against the USA and the Euro U21 qualifier against Norway.

The Reds' duo are joined by a host of big names, including Arsenal's Calum Chambers, Tottenham Hotspur's Eric Dier, Manchester United's James Wilson and Chelsea's Ruben Loftus-Cheek.

The full squad, courtesy of Nicholas Veevers of the Football Association's official website:

Goalkeepers: Angus Gunn (Manchester City), Jordan Pickford (Preston North End [on loan from Sunderland]), Christian Walton (Bury [on loan from Brighton & Hove Albion])

Defenders: Calum Chambers (Arsenal), Eric Dier (Tottenham Hotspur), Brendan Galloway (Everton), Joe Gomez (Liverpool), Kortney Hause (Wolverhampton Wanderers), Dominic Iorfa (Wolverhampton Wanderers), Jack Stephens (Middlesbrough [on loan from Southampton]), Matt Targett (Southampton)

Midfielders: Dele Alli (Tottenham Hotspur), Nathaniel Chalobah (Chelsea), Jake Forster-Caskey (Brighton & Hove Albion), Ruben Loftus-Cheek (Chelsea), James Ward-Prowse (Southampton)

Forwards: Chuba Akpom (Hull City [on loan from Arsenal]), Jordon Ibe (Liverpool), Solly March (Brighton & Hove Albion), Nathan Redmond (Norwich City), Duncan Watmore (Sunderland), James Wilson (Manchester United), Cauley Woodrow (Fulham)

Ibe and Gomez have both enjoyed excellent starts to the 2015-16 Premier League season, with the latter in particular impressing after joining the Reds from Charlton Athletic earlier this summer. While it may only be Gomez's first call-up to the squad, the Liverpool youngster has a solid chance of starting at least one of the two matches. Notable absentees from the squad include Everton's John Stones and United's Luke Shaw, but the duo are likely to be called up to the senior side.

England will play the USA on Thursday, September 3, before starting their qualifying campaign against Norway the following Monday.
